Across generations, 'Harlen' has shown interesting popularity patterns: Among the G.I. Generation (1901-1927), it ranked 1130th out of 7545 names. Among the Silent Generation (1928-1945), it ranked 952nd out of 6773 names. Among the Baby Boomers (1946-1964), it ranked 1549th out of 7552 names. Among the Generation X (Gen X) (1965-1980), it ranked 2639th out of 10718 names. Among the Millennials (Gen Y) (1981-1996), it ranked 4682nd out of 16616 names. Among the Generation Z (Gen Z or Zoomers) (1997-2012), it ranked 3944th out of 24088 names. Among the Generation Alpha (2013-2024), it ranked 2409th out of 23106 names. "Harlen" Popularity Across American Generations
Generation | Gender | Rank | Total Names |
---|---|---|---|
G.I. Generation (1901-1927) | Boy | 1130th of 7545 | 618 |
Silent Generation (1928-1945) | Boy | 952nd of 6773 | 830 |
Baby Boomers (1946-1964) | Boy | 1549th of 7552 | 486 |
Generation X (Gen X) (1965-1980) | Boy | 2639th of 10718 | 222 |
Millennials (Gen Y) (1981-1996) | Boy | 4682nd of 16616 | 159 |
Generation Z (Gen Z or Zoomers) (1997-2012) | Boy | 3944th of 24088 | 363 |
Generation Alpha (2013-2024) | Boy | 2409th of 23106 | 667 |
